Lewicki, Essentials of Negotiation explores the core concepts and theories of the psychology of bargaining and negotiation, and the dynamics of interpersonal and inter-group conflict and its resolution in a succinct format. Lewicki, Second Canadian Edition is ideal for a one semester course or for an executive program. For users of the US (comprehensive) Lewicki text, 14 of the 20 chapters have been included in the Canadian Second Edition. Chapters are shortened by removing more "academic" material and some of the boxes. This effectively leaves the message and theories of negotiation intact, while adding substantial material such as mediation, arbitration, and managing difficult negotiations - topics deemed imperative by the Canadian market.
